Hyundai Inster goes on showroom tour
September 1, 2024
British customers will get their first chance to see Hyundai’s new Inster model as it embarks on a national roadshow from October to December, visiting 86 showrooms during its journey.

Pre-production versions of the A-segment sub-compact SUV, which was revealed in June, will be on display ahead of the order books opening later this year with the first deliveries in January.
It’s the perfect opportunity to get up close to Hyundai’s latest electric vehicle with major parts of the United Kingdom covered, from Inverness to Taunton and Aberystwyth to Norwich. Unveiled at the Busan International Mobility Show in Korea, the Inster made a positive first
impression courtesy of its robust exterior design, spacious interior and sophisticated technology in an urban-friendly SUV package.
Building on the design legacy of the Casper, a petrol-powered model available in Korea, the Inster will be positioned between traditional A-segment sub-compact city cars and larger B-segment compact models, offering a blend of manoeuvrability and ease of use with strong practicality and flexibility.
The characterful exterior design, with its small SUV profile, bold wheel arches, distinctive LED lighting and elevated ride height is complemented by a sleek cockpit that provides enhanced technology thanks to a 10.25-inch digital cluster and a 10.25-inch infotainment touchscreen, plus a wireless charging dock in the centre console.
The Inster offers great versatility, too, with all the seats able to be folded flat, to maximise capacity, while those in the second row slide and can be split 50:50, adding to the versatility.
Performance-wise, there are both 42kWh and Long Range 49kWh batteries available, allied to an electric motor that delivers either 71.1kW (97PS) or 84.5kW (115PS). This allows the Inster to deliver a driving range of up to 220 miles (WLTP) with 15-inch wheels on a single charge.
And with a suite of advanced driver assistance systems, including Surround View Monitor, Blind-spot View Monitor and Intelligent Speed Assist, the model offers a comfortable and safe driving experience, either in urban environments or out of town.
